One day at a time. And when you're counting up bad days, make sure you count up the good days too! Give yourself lots of short term goals and leave the distant future in the distant future. You can only do today.

Hey your here and thats a step in the right direction!!!

I have stuggled for a long time and my "LIGHTBULB" moment came when I had the relization on being 50 and still chubby! I want to be 33 and feel and look great! so when I am running I just remember what my goals are and when I want to obtain them and that keeps me motivated. I dont have a problem working out, its the eating that gets me everytime. I have found that if I create a menu for a week it helps me stay focused! I may not follow it for every meal, yet when I am hungry I know what i can eat instead of finding junk!! good luck!!! Keep posting and try to post your daily menu its a fun was to stay accountable! bye
